JERRY'S POV.

Tomorrow's Sunday!

You see, the thing about exam periods for me is that I freak out at the slightest thing. I feel stressed and tensed at the same time that it makes me wonder if I'm normal. Don't answer that, please.

Permit me to ask if its normal for someone, who is accustomed to church going every Sunday, to just suddenly feel uneasy and uncomfortable at the slightest mention of the activity. I honestly don't think its normal. I am not saying I'm not normal, it's just.. Forget it!

I am at home this Saturday, as expected, and luckily for the family, there's light. I mean, power. Unlike some places on our dear earth, here we don't have a 24 hour supply of electricity. Honestly, any day the light stays for more than eight to ten hours, without blinking, I have every reason to believe and deduce that Something is Wrong. Now that's abnormal.

The light is only expected to last that long during events and special holidays like the Easter holiday and Christmas. Even on these days, the light is not expected to exceed a span of twelve hours straight. It's normal to experience black out for two months but its weird to have electricity for twenty four hours. How does that sound. Welcome to the dark continent.

I'm not complaining. Though it would be nice to have such growth in our economy but I still think it would be kinda weird.

I am tired of staying in my room, so I decide to go to the sitting room and know who's at home as well. I smile in my head when it occurs to me that I haven't left my room since morning and its ten a.m. now. Well, that means I have missed all the work at home. Sweet.

I head to the sitting room with just my sweatpants on and nothing on top. Yes, I am shirtless but trust me, its not a sight you would want to behold. Don't mind all those WattPad books that adore shirtless guys with all their eight packs and six pack and stuff. I gat none of those and I'm proud of myself.

I smile at my sisters who are busy watching Avatar, The Legend of Korra. Its the sequel to Avatar, The Last Air Bender. That's the one I like. I've watched both and honestly Aang is overrated. I just love those guys especially Sokka.

I sit on a cushion and bring out my phone. Of course I'm not going to watch this movie with them. I am just bored of staying in my room, alone.

I open my menu and go through the games I have and settle on playing Fashion Empire. Its a ladies game I must admit, but then its me. And believe when I tell you that I am really into this game. Its freaking awesome. The levels are challenging, the graphics are classic, the gameplay are on point and the story line is simply addictive.

I am engrossed in the game that I don't know when Jessica came in. She has been given the liberty of coming anytime she wants to. That's my mum for you.

After I introduced Jessica to my mom last week, Jessica now comes here without even informing me. She eats with us and does other things here. Its now like she's part of the family. The only person that doesn't seem comfortable with this is Joy, and me.

As I look up and meet Jessica's eyes, I sigh and get up almost immediately and start heading to my room. She's never seen me shirtless. This is why I'm just uncomfortable with her impromptu visits. Its just abnormal you know.

Luckily, she seems to understand that I'm not comfortable with her seeing me shirtless as she does not call me or try to stop me. Joy stands up and follows me out. She catches up easily

"She should stop these her visits oo" She blurts out

"Ha! Why?" I'm not playing that game with her.

"Jerry, I know you're not comfortable with it and so am I." She taps me on my shoulder.

"Well," I shrug, "Mummy is not complaining, why should I?"

"That's the problem!" She sighs and shakes her head.

"So you hate her?" Am just curious!

"No. I mean she's your girlfriend, right?" She did not just say that.

"What!?" I glare at her. "She's not my girlfriend"

"Yeah, right" She sarcastically replies. This girl is unbelievable.

"You know what? Just leave me alone, lemme go and wear shirt" I can't continue with her.

"I still think you should talk to her about the visits. She's beginning to freak me out with her obsession." She turns and starts heading to the parlor but stops abruptly.

I turn my back to know why she suddenly stopped walking. And I meet Her eyes. How long has she been there, listening. I don't bother, I just walk to my room and grab a shirt before going back to the parlor. To probably face my worst nightmare, well not literally.

I enter the sitting room and walk up to her seat. Grab her hands and drag her outside. Luckily for me, she did not resist. She just followed me, willingly. Too much for dragging her, eh!

"I want to tell you something" I blurt out as soon as we got outside.

"If its about my visits, then don't worry. I'll minimize them and always alert you before coming." She says.

"I'm guessing you overheard I and Joy's conversation" I bring my head down.

"Obviously, plus she kinda already told me about it." She's in thought. Probably reliving whatever it is that Joy told her.

That girl may be the last born, but she's scary whenever she gives us warnings or tell us her mind and opinion. I respect her for that. And so does everyone. I wonder what she really told Jessica and How she did so.

Jessica chuckles. "She's quite funny, if I may say."

"You can say that again" I look at her and she's kinda still in thoughts. Hmmm. "What exactly did she tell you?"

"I can't tell you that, in details." She laughs softly. "But she mentioned something about you being uncomfortable with me seeing you shirtless" Okay now she's smirking. At me!

"Of course she did" I say more like to myself.

"Oh come on" she hits me lightly, near my chest. "There's nothing to hide. You don't even have abs." She's still smirking is all I can register.

"That's the whole point of me being uncomfortable" I whispered, but she still seems to hear me and begins to laugh. Seriously!

"Please, what's funny!" Great, now I'm asking the obvious. Smooth Jay.

She just continues laughing, ignoring me. I decide that I've had enough of her and start to head back inside. She then decides to stop laughing and holds me back. What now.

"What now!" I ask her without even raising my head. Its funny how uncomfortable and shy and nervous she makes me feel all at the same time.

She's not responding so I guess she's just looking at me. Great. Now I'm shaking.

"Aunty, your phone is ringing."

We both turn to see Joy coming out with Jessica's phone, ringing. She grabs it and quickly answer the call with a casual 'Hello' and goes a distance. She just wants her privacy. Why won't she gimme mine. Girls!

"Chibu!" Is mummy calling me? I thought she went out.

"Chibu! Open the gate!"

"I'm coming" Joy outruns me to the gate.

As she opens the gate and mummy comes in, I notice that she's not with her vehicle and she came back with a little girl. Strange.

"Mummy, welcome. Where's your car?" I greet and ask her, curiously.

"The car broke down at Ogbunike, so I just parked it there." Great, so she went to her village. Thank God I stayed in my room.

"Who's the girl with you?" Joy asks as she grabs mummy's bag and I get the sack of stuffs she bought. This bag is heavy.

"She's your cousin," How many of them don't I know. Quite a lot. "and she'll be staying with us  from now." What!?

"WHAT!?" Joy and I shout simultaneously.

"Welcome ma" Jessica greets. I guess she's done with the phone call.

"Jessica, how are you" Mummy casually asks without stopping. She's tired, obviously.

As soon as mummy enters the house, Jessica comes before me and stops me.

"Clara called" So it was Clara after all. Girls.

"So!?" Why's she telling me.

"Chris is with her at her house". That's not a new story.

"So!?"

"Chris was beaten up"

I dropped the sack I was carrying. Am sure something broke inside though. I look up at her as of to confirm if she's joking or not. She's not!

Oh-No!
